Title: The Innovations of Dave Dalglish
Introduction
Dave Dalglish is an accomplished inventor based in Longmont, Colorado. He has made significant contributions to the field of radio frequency identification (RFID) technology. With a total of two patents to his name, Dalglish has demonstrated his expertise and innovative spirit in the industry.
Latest Patents
Dalglish's latest patents focus on a selective cloaking circuit for use in RFID systems. This innovative method allows the output to the antenna of an RFID tag or label to be disconnected from the balance of the RFID chip. A series switch, activated by a logic command generated by the RFID chip, facilitates this disconnection. The output to the antenna is temporarily disabled, allowing other RFID tags in an RF interrogation field to be identified without interference. Importantly, the input of the antenna remains connected, enabling it to receive commands that can lift the tag out of cloaking and allow it to selectively output its signal.
